RIYADH: A veteran Lebanese economist and political adviser has criticized some US media coverage for portraying Iran as the war’s victor. In his opinion, much of the analysis reflects domestic political divides more than realities on the ground. “I’m very disappointed with the analysis you get from the mainstream media in America,” Nadim Shehadi said on the Arab News current affairs program “Frankly Speaking.” “All of this is Washington political analysis.
